A very tidy 10 unit motel with a large owners residence, with a growing turnover and steady business history. Originally built as a 7 unit motel, the previous owner built three additional units to enhance the business opportunities that were presenting themselves and at the same time, built a dedicated office/reception area. While building the additional units, the original units were stripped bare and totally refurbished to the same quality, so basically we have a new 10 unit motel. The current owner has carried on with the improvements and put some work into redecorating the house, so there is little maintenance left.
Being the only motel that backs onto Stadium Southland and the new Velodrome has an advatage of being first fill when there are events on in town. With the added bonus every year of the cycle classic, "Tour of Southland", adding a full motel occupancy for over a week at a time.
Invercargill has a steadying occupancy all year round, due to there not being an over supply of accommodation and the need for servicing of a large commercial and rural area. Recent discovery of gas deposits off the southland coast and the huge impact of the dairy business on the region, will see this city continue to shine.
